mirror of
https://github.com/InsanusMokrassar/BooruGrabberTelegramBot.git
synced 2024-11-21 15:43:46 +00:00
fixes
This commit is contained in:
parent
edf6c9717b
commit
4a90e0f427
@ -2,6 +2,6 @@ FROM adoptopenjdk/openjdk11
|
|||||||
|
|
||||||
USER 1000
|
USER 1000
|
||||||
|
|
||||||
ENTRYPOINT ["/booru_grabber_bot/bin/booru_grabber_bot", "/booru_grabber_bot/local.config.json"]
|
ENTRYPOINT ["/booru_grabber_bot/bin/booru_grabber_bot", "/booru_grabber_bot/config.json"]
|
||||||
|
|
||||||
ADD ./build/distributions/booru_grabber_bot.tar /
|
ADD ./build/distributions/booru_grabber_bot.tar /
|
||||||
|
@ -17,7 +17,7 @@ app=booru_grabber_bot
|
|||||||
version=0.0.1
|
version=0.0.1
|
||||||
server=hub.docker.com
|
server=hub.docker.com
|
||||||
|
|
||||||
assert_success ../gradlew build
|
assert_success ./gradlew build
|
||||||
# scp ./build/distributions/AutoPostTestTelegramBot-1.0.0.zip ./config.json developer@insanusmokrassar.dev:/tmp/
|
# scp ./build/distributions/AutoPostTestTelegramBot-1.0.0.zip ./config.json developer@insanusmokrassar.dev:/tmp/
|
||||||
assert_success sudo docker build -t $app:"$version" .
|
assert_success sudo docker build -t $app:"$version" .
|
||||||
assert_success sudo docker tag $app:"$version" $server/$app:$version
|
assert_success sudo docker tag $app:"$version" $server/$app:$version
|
||||||
|
@ -89,7 +89,7 @@ suspend fun main(args: Array<String>) {
|
|||||||
val images = settings.makeRequest(i).takeIf { it.isNotEmpty() } ?: break
|
val images = settings.makeRequest(i).takeIf { it.isNotEmpty() } ?: break
|
||||||
result.addAll(
|
result.addAll(
|
||||||
images.filterNot {
|
images.filterNot {
|
||||||
chatsUrlsSeen.contains(chatId, it.url)
|
chatsUrlsSeen.contains(chatId, it.url ?: return@filterNot true)
|
||||||
}
|
}
|
||||||
)
|
)
|
||||||
i++
|
i++
|
||||||
|
@ -41,7 +41,7 @@ data class ChatSettings(
|
|||||||
|
|
||||||
suspend fun makeRequest(page: Int): List<BoardImage> {
|
suspend fun makeRequest(page: Int): List<BoardImage> {
|
||||||
return withContext(Dispatchers.IO) {
|
return withContext(Dispatchers.IO) {
|
||||||
board.search(page, count, query, rating).blocking()
|
board.search(page, count, query, rating).blocking() ?: emptyList()
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user